Golf cart ownership comes with the responsibility of safely maintaining its batteries. This article offers essential charging safety tips for golf cart owners. Using the right charger, adequate ventilation, and proper cable inspection are among the recommendations. Avoiding overcharging, keeping the charging area dry, and using dedicated outlets are crucial practices. Safety measures also include disconnecting the charger correctly, preventing circuit overloads, and employing surge protectors. Additionally, understanding your battery type and following manufacturer guidelines are vital. By following these safety tips and staying informed, golf cart owners can safeguard themselves, their batteries, and enjoy their golfing experiences with peace of mind.
